Cross-pondization

What is Cross-pondization?


1.

The transfer of information, intellectual property, ideas, business contacts, etc. between a U.S. entity and a UK entity, to create and grow a new business relationship.

There was a lot of cross-pondization going on at the Affiliate Summit 2007 London Conference when US and UK affiliates, merchants and networks got together to discuss cross-border affiliate marketing opportunities.
